Quick Answer:A full-time police officer in Tulare, CA earns a median $111,692/year (≈ $53.69/hour) in nominal terms for 2026 — projected from BLS OEWS 2025 (SOC 33-3051). Once you factor in Tulare's price level (13% above national, BEA RPP 113.1), that paycheck buys what $98,755 would nationally. Nominal pay sits 1.0% above the California state average.

YearAnnual SalaryStatus
2019$89,804Actual
2020$93,203Actual
2021$91,880Actual
2022$93,558Actual
2023$102,787Actual
2024$123,408Actual
2025$108,376Actual
2026(current)$111,692Estimated
2027$115,110Projected

Based on 7 years of BLS OEWS data for the Tulare metropolitan area, the median police officer salary grew 20.7% from $89,804 (2019) to $108,376 (2025). At a 3.06% compound annual growth rate, salaries are projected to reach $115,110 by 2027 — a total increase of $25,306 (28.18%) from 2019.

Note: Historical values (20192025) are actual BLS OEWS figures for the Tulare metropolitan area, sourced from annual Occupational Employment and Wage Statistics surveys. 20262026 figures are current estimates, and 2027 values are projections, calculated using a 3.06% CAGR derived from 7-year BLS historical data.
